# Screenplay Parser — interactive demo
Paste a Fountain-format screenplay or upload a `.fdx` file. Get structured JSON output with scenes, characters, dialogue counts, and shot estimates.
Built from the open-source library [mcqx4/screenplay-parser](https://github.com/mcqx4/screenplay-parser).
## Use cases
- **AI pre-production tools** — preprocess scripts before feeding to image-generation pipelines
- **Script analysis** — count scenes, identify main characters, estimate runtime
- **Tooling integration** — convert legacy `.fdx` files to JSON for modern workflows
